A study is made of the sensitization of triphenylamine-containing polyimide
s in the IR and visible regions of the spectrum (500-1200 nm). These polyim
ides are the most promising of the aromatic polymers for making recording m
edia; when sensitized by the most efficient dyes for the IR region of the s
pectrum, the photosensitivity at wavelength 1060 nm is 5 x 10(3) cm(2)/J, w
hich is an order of magnitude greater than that achieved for other polymers
